How to prevent liver cancer better? Five small ways to prevent liver cancer should be remembered

Liver cancer is the most serious liver disease. It may cause the patient's death. The occurrence of liver cancer is not accidental. Many people develop liver cancer due to long-term lack of treatment after the onset of liver disease. In daily life, we should also learn more about the relevant measures to prevent liver cancer and prevent the occurrence of liver cancer.

The liver is one of the most important organs in the human body. The most serious liver disease is liver cancer. After the occurrence of liver cancer, it will seriously damage the patient's health and may also cause the patient's death. Everyone should also take preventive measures to prevent liver cancer. The following is an introduction to the prevention of liver cancer. So, how to prevent liver cancer?

1. Prevent hepatitis. The occurrence of liver cancer is directly related to chronic hepatitis. If chronic hepatitis is not treated for a long time, it will gradually deteriorate into cirrhosis and liver cancer. When you come into contact with hepatitis patients in daily life, you should also prevent yourself from being infected with hepatitis.

2. Adjust your diet. Everyone should develop good eating habits in their daily lives. Wash your hands before eating any food. When eating fruits and vegetables, wash off the residual pesticides on them. Also, keep the food fresh. Do not eat half-cooked food, let alone moldy food.

3. Clean water source. Long-term consumption of polluted water sources can easily cause liver cancer. When drinking water daily, you must pay attention to the hygiene of the water source, especially in remote mountainous areas, and avoid using river water and pond water.

4. Stay away from alcohol and tobacco. Alcohol can damage the liver. Long-term drinking can lead to fatty liver and cirrhosis, which can slowly turn into liver cancer. Long-term smoking can cause cancerous changes in cells in the body, which can turn into liver cancer. Everyone must stay away from alcohol and tobacco in their daily lives.

5. Get more sun exposure. When the weather is good, you can get more sun exposure. Frequent sun exposure can promote the formation of vitamin D, which can prevent liver cancer, breast cancer, lymphoma and many other cancers.
